IMPROV FOUNDATION 4

Tuesdays 6pm-9pm (3 Hours)

October 6 - October 27

Anders Yates, Instructor

Description: Improv Foundation 4 utilizes everything learned so far, but dives further into embodying characters and emotions, introduces the 'game of the scene', and introductory longform techniques.

Goal: To build on the skills from Improv Foundation 1, 2 and 3, tighten scene work and learn basic longform techniques. Students will have a showcase performance at the end of term.

Prerequisite: Improv Foundation 3 or equivalent

Class Size: 10 people max

Duration: 12 hours total - 4 week (3 Hr/Class) format. See section details.

Location: Bad Dog Studio (392 Spadina Ave)

Price: $350+HST

Anders Yates

Anders Yates is an improviser, actor, writer, teacher and comedian originally from Montréal. His improv and sketch comedy troupe Uncalled For has toured North America performing at countless festivals, and he currently is a cast member in the Second City Touring Company. Anders' solo sketch comedy has won him accolades and awards, including the Outstanding Solo Performance award from My Entertainment World and Best of the Fest from the Montréal Sketchfest. He spent several years as a contributor to the satirical news site The Beaverton and has an extensive career in film and television.
